How much do remote visual foxpro develop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ote visual foxpro developer in Lockhart, TX is $52.28,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47.93 and $56.54 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Remote Visual FoxPro developer?

A Remote Visual FoxPro Developer is a software professional who specializes in building, maintaining, and upgrading applications using Microsoft's Visual FoxPro programming language, often working from a remote location. Their responsibilities typically include database management, bug fixing, code optimization, and migrating legacy systems to newer platforms. They collaborate with clients or teams online, leveraging their expertise in Visual FoxPro to support business applications that rely on this technology. Since Visual FoxPro is a legacy language, these developers are particularly valuable for organizations with existing FoxPro applications that require ongoing support or modernization.

What are some common challenges faced by Remote Visual FoxPro developers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ote Visual Foxpro Developers often encounter challenges related to legacy code maintenance and integration with newer technologies. Since Visual Foxpro is a discontinued product, documentation and community support can be limited, requiring strong problem-solving skills and resourcefulness. Effective communication with team members is essential, as remote environments can make collaboration more challenging, especially when clarifying requirements or coordinating code changes. To succeed, developers should proactively document their work, leverage online forums, and maintain clear communication channels with clients and colleagues.

Responsibilities

The Power BI Developer is responsible for architecting and delivering robust business intelligence, reporting, and data visualization solutions that enable agency-wide insight and informed decision-making. This role builds complex dimensional data models, develops interactive dashboards and reports, and transforms data into clear, compelling, and actionable visual narratives for business and technical stakeholders. 

The developer works as an integral member of a cross-functional software delivery team and participates throughout the software development life cycle, including discovery, requirements analysis, solution design, development, testing, deployment, documentation, maintenance, and continuous improvement. Power BI reports and dashboards are treated as components of broader software, data, and business-process solutions rather than as standalone deliverables.

The developer collaborates closely with business analysts, application developers, data professionals, architects, quality assurance staff, project leadership, and business stakeholders to define requirements and deliver scalable reporting solutions. Responsibilities include evaluating data sources and dependencies, contributing to technical design decisions, establishing appropriate data models, validating data accuracy, supporting user acceptance testing, and coordinating changes across reporting, application, database, and integration components. 

This role is expected to produce solutions that are secure, accessible, maintainable, testable, reusable, and supportable in production. The developer follows established team standards for source control, peer review, release management, documentation, defect resolution, and change management. 

The position also contributes to troubleshooting and resolving issues across the reporting solution, including problems involving data quality, data transformation, semantic models, application workflows, performance, security, or deployment. This position requires at least eight years of hands-on Power BI experience and the ability to independently perform a broad range of highly complex technical work. The ideal candidate applies sound technical judgment, plans and executes work with minimal oversight, communicates risks and dependencies, and brings a high level of creativity, initiative, and problem-solving ability to each engagement.

The developer must be able to work effectively in an iterative, team-based software development environment, participate constructively in planning and technical discussions, estimate and communicate work status, respond to changing priorities, and take shared ownership of overall solution quality. This role may lead projects, coordinate reporting workstreams, conduct technical reviews, establish development standards, or provide guidance and mentoring to other team members as needed.
